    Walking the Huntington Library and Gardens Trail is a great outdoor experience in Los Angeles that is suitable for all ages and skill levels. While out on the trail, you will meander through an interconnected network of walking paths and explore a well-manicured garden filled with a variety of plants. Those looking to explore the gardens should take note that there is a fee of $25 during the week and $29 on the weekends to access the area.

    Route Description for Huntington Library and Gardens Trail

    The Huntington Library and Gardens Trail is less of a hike and more of a leisurely stroll, but that doesn’t stop it from being a popular outdoor activity in the L.A. area. Featuring a beautiful garden setting that will take hours to fully explore, this is the perfect route to explore if you are after a relaxing excursion with the family.

    From the parking lot, you will make your way south along the trail as it leads past the library and towards the Palm Garden. Here, you will make your way west in order to experience the beauty of the Jungle, Subtropical, and Rose gardens, before turning to the north. Take your time through these areas in order to fully appreciate the beauty of the plant life that can be found here.

    After passing by the European Art and American Art buildings, the trail will loop around to the south, leading you through the Chinese Garden and Japanese Garden. Now making your way back to the northeast, you will eventually arrive back at the parking area where you began.

    Getting to the Huntington Library and Gardens Trail Trailhead

    The starting point for the Huntington Library and Gardens Trail can be found at the parking lot on the corner of Orlando Road and W Bound Drive.
